SYSTRA is one of the world's leading engineering and consultancy groups specializing in public transport and sustainable mobility. With over 11,000 employees worldwide, SYSTRA's mission is to design safe and sustainable transport solutions to bring people together, develop social inclusion and facilitate access to employment, education and leisure throughout the world. 

 

For 65 years, the Group has been working alongside cities and regions to contribute to their development by creating, improving and modernising their infrastructure and transport systems, throughout the life cycle of their projects. SYSTRA is involved from the earliest stages of design through to the testing, deployment and maintenance phases. The company provides all its services in over 80 countries worldwide and generates  roughly 70-76%  of its turnover internationally. With its new services, SYSTRA supports its clients and partners in their digital, ecological and energy transition, in order to invent the mobility of tomorrow.

Context

SYSTRA Taiwan Branch is dedicated to Taiwan and the Group's global rail transit system-related projects, encompassing feasibility analysis, system design, project management, testing and integration, trial operation, and commissioning operations. Currently, we are actively participating in rail transportation projects across Taiwan, with offices located in Taipei and Kaohsiung.
